Should I use my bank to transfer money from Georgia to Cuba?
There are two distinct ways that banks make money on international funds transfers. First, by charging steep transaction fees, and second, by providing a low GEL to CUP exchange rate. Sometimes, the actual transaction fee may not be that high, but the rate may be much lower, which essentially means a hidden fee as the cost of the transfer for you still goes up.Since your obvious goal is to make the most of your hard earned money, you would want to ensure that the receiver of your money gets the maximum amount. One simple way to achieve this is by minimizing the fees on Georgia to Cuba money you send. And, generally, you will not get low fees with banks. How to send money from Georgia to Cuba fast?
It could be a stressful experience if you need to rush money quickly from Georgia to Cuba. How do you decide which option to pick to ensure your funds arrive at the destination in the fastest possible way?First, you should ensure that you are picking the right payment method to convert GEL to CUP. Most remittance companies will allow you to pay by cash, with credit or debit cards, via a direct bank transfer, through a wire transfer, and so on. Digital payment methods like wire transfers and bank transfers will certainly delay your transaction as compared to cash payments.
Similarly, on the receiving side, your recipient also has multiple options to collect their monies in Cuban Peso. The payout choices generally include cash pickup, direct bank transfer, loading up a mobile wallet, and mobile airtime top up. If transaction speed is important, you could choose cash pickup if the receiver can access a close by pickup location. Just be aware that the exchange rate on cash transactions may not be the best, and there is risk in handling cash, especially for larger amounts. Otherwise, a mobile airtime top up or a bank deposit may be the next fastest possible ways unless there are bank holidays going on.
Foreign exchange transaction speed also depends on some additional factors like transfer amount, compliance and regulatory processes and vary from provider to provider. Step by step guide to transfer money to Cuba from Georgia
There are many important aspects of Georgia to Cuba remittances that will impact the yield you get. The most important one is the selection of the best money transfer company. For this, you can rely on RemitFinder's expertise in searching and comparing many global companies to present you many options in one simple, easy to understand view.Once you have honed down on the company you want to go with, the below step by step tutorial will help you execute your transfer in an effective manner.
- Step 1 - Create your account with the chosen remittance company. Please be aware that you will likely be asked for identification documents and personal information. This is an important step for the company to ensure that you are a genuine person and ensure you comply with various legal regulations like anti money laundering.
- Step 2 - Provision the manner in which you will fund your remittance transaction. The forex company may accept payment in multiple ways - Georgia bank account, credit and debit cards, and sometimes even cash that you can pay with by walking into a branch or outlet.
- Step 3 - Similar to the previous step, also provision the manner in which the receiver will access the funds. The most common delivery methods include CUP bank deposit, cash pick up in a physical provider location or agent's office, mobile wallet credit and mobile airtime popup.
- Step 4 - Provision recipient details including name and address.
- Step 5 - Decide how much Georgian Lari amount you want to send from Georgia.
- Step 6 - Optionally, check if there are any deals or promotions going on. You can rely on RemitFinder to provide you this information. Discounts help you save even more, so be sure to use one if available.
- Step 7 - Validate all the information for accuracy and start your transaction.
